WebReferrals to our DESMOND team can be made via an individual’s GP surgery or self-referral can be completed over the phone or by email. Individuals must be over the age of 18 years old, have a confirmed diagnosis of type 2 diabetes and a Nottinghamshire County GP in order to access the service.
